Four Ways for Sales and Marketing Pros to Segment Their Target Market
Philip Kotler reminds us that if markets are to be segmented and cultivated, they must meet certain requirements. Segments must be: 1. Measurable 2. Substantial 3. Accessible 4. Differentiable 5. Actionable Assuming your target markets meet those requirements, sales and marketing professionals can cultivate these segments to maximize their potential. There are four ways to segment any given market and the choices you make regarding how to segment will impact the quality of your efforts.

Lead Generation Best Practices: Segment & Test Your Market
  • Append data points like SIC code, revenue and employee size to contact records.
  • Segment your market database into testable sample cells.
  • Test the cells to determine high-value and most-likely-to-buy segments.
  • Deploy a full court press against segments with the highest lead rates.
